This charming petite creamer from early 20th century Savoy is formed with a rounded body, a gently curved handle, and a neatly pinched spout. The cinnamon-toned glaze is enlivened by soft cream dots, each hand-applied in circular rings with a faint halo effect, adding rhythm and a playful, spontaneous quality to the glossy surface. The interior is finished in a warm beige tone, creating a pleasing contrast with the richer exterior. It shows age with small chips to the lip and foot, minor glaze losses along the rim, and light surface wear consistent with use.
